Common Med Spa Franchise Ownership Challenges

Most med spa franchise owners experience a predictable set of hurdles as they shift from startup to growth.

  • Hiring and retaining qualified providers: Competition for experienced injectors, aestheticians, and clinical staff is strong, and turnover can disrupt both scheduling and the client experience.
  • Maintaining consistent operations: Delivering the same standard of care across staff, shifts, and locations requires clear processes, training, and ongoing quality checks.
  • Building local awareness: Even with a recognized brand, each market still needs localized marketing, community visibility, and a plan to generate repeat visits—not just first-time bookings.
  • Managing regulatory requirements: Med spas face overlapping clinical and business compliance demands, and staying current on supervision rules, documentation, and advertising guidelines is essential.

None of these med spa franchise challenges are unusual. What matters is addressing them systematically—using defined workflows, measurable standards, and regular review—so issues are handled early and performance stays predictable.

Staffing and Team Management

People really are the foundation of a med spa. Clients are putting their trust in licensed professionals for treatments that must be performed safely and consistently, so building the right team isn’t optional—it’s core to the business.

Hiring Qualified Providers

Skilled injectors, nurses, and aestheticians are in high demand, so hiring must be approached strategically. Franchise owners benefit from a clear process, which includes:

  • Defining what “qualified” means for each role
  • Outlining responsibilities and expectations from the start
  • Running a consistent interview and screening process
  • Implementing a strong onboarding plan to ensure new hires understand the standards from day one

While pay is a factor, it’s not the only one that matters. Medical providers also care about the work environment, including training, support, leadership, and a professional team culture. When these elements are established early, the chances of turnover or inconsistent performance decrease significantly.

Training and Retention

Hiring great people is step one. Keeping them is where the real work begins. Ongoing education helps providers stay confident, improve technique, and stay aligned with your brand’s standards. Regular check-ins, clear expectations, and consistent communication go a long way here.

When team members feel supported and see opportunities for growth—like training, new responsibilities, or leadership roles—they’re more likely to stay and grow with the business.

Operational and Financial Pressures

Running a med spa goes beyond providing treatments alone. Owners need to manage costs, maintain service quality, and track performance while staying on top of all the details.

Managing Costs

Payroll, equipment, leases, and marketing all need careful attention. Successful franchise owners regularly analyze performance data and compare results to system benchmarks. Clear reporting and well-defined processes make decision-making easier and help eliminate unnecessary guesswork.

Maintaining Service Quality

Consistency is key to building trust. Clients expect the same high standards with every visit, from treatment results to the overall experience. Standard operating procedures, solid training protocols, and regular quality checks help ensure that growth doesn’t compromise service standards.

Tracking Performance

Monitoring key metrics like appointment utilization, membership participation, and client retention gives owners a clear view of business health. Regularly reviewing performance helps identify trends early, allowing owners to adjust strategies before small issues become bigger problems.

Marketing and Growth Obstacles

Even with strong national brand recognition, local marketing plays a crucial role in driving success.

Building Awareness

Grand opening campaigns, digital advertising, and community outreach are key to gaining early traction. Franchise owners who stay actively engaged in their local market tend to build stronger brand visibility and generate more word-of-mouth referrals.

Competing Locally

Every market has its own unique dynamics. Clear messaging that highlights personalized care, non-invasive treatments, and premium service providers helps set the business apart. Consistency across marketing channels also reinforces credibility and ensures the brand stays top of mind.

Using Franchisor Support

One of the major advantages of franchise ownership is having access to established systems. Marketing templates, vendor relationships, operational playbooks, and ongoing guidance all help reduce the learning curve. Franchise owners who make full use of these resources can navigate challenges more efficiently and avoid common franchise problems.

Overcoming Franchise Challenges

Successfully overcoming med spa franchise challenges comes down to having the right structure and strong leadership.

Lean on Franchise Systems

Franchise models provide a clear structure to follow. With established branding, defined processes, and operational support, owners have a solid framework that can be refined as needed. Using these systems properly allows franchisees to focus on execution instead of constantly reinventing the wheel.

Build Strong Processes

Documented workflows and clear accountability help ensure daily operations run smoothly. When expectations are well-defined, teams perform more consistently. Strong processes also make it easier to manage future expansion, especially for owners with multiple units.

Focus on Leadership

Leadership plays a critical role in shaping the business. Owners who communicate clearly, set measurable goals, and remain engaged with their teams create stronger cultures and more stable operations. A practical, solutions-focused mindset helps address challenges efficiently and resolve them quickly.
